This week's PDCC77 color combo hearkens the soft neutrals of springtime emerging from winter: green, white, and brown. Here is their inspiration photo:
And here is my CAS card based on this lovely color scheme:
Here is a close-up of the center flower piece:
Ingredients:
Cardstock: Bazzill
Twine: Jillibean Soup
Ink: Memento Rich Cocoa and ColorBox Fluid Chalk Cat's Eye in Chestnut Roan and Creamy Brown
Stamp: DeNami Design Thank You Circle
Flower: Petaloo by Flora Doodles
Glitter: Elizabeth Craft Design GlitterRitz in Peridot
